how do you plan to address the issue with the homeless use of the public spaces yeah so I mean I will work closely with uh our police department and our fire department you know um the firefighters are they're pairing up with a group that's the alternative response team so they're working with Family and Children Services and this team will then go out and interface with our homeless and I think that's the best way to make sure they in the services they need you know it doesn't do a lot of good to just throw them in jail or find them finds that they're you know they're never going to be able to pay but getting them the services that they need and I think we all recognize that there's a lot of mental health issues with many of our homeless and getting them you know the treatment they need and we have a new 106 bed hospital Mental Health Hospital coming out of the ground and doors will be opening in 26 that's going to be a huge help I'm also grateful to Parkside they're working a lot with our juveniles and that's kind of a specialty for them much needed and it's there now so you know that's going to be a big help and we've got of course Family and Children Services they're doing amazing work and uh we've got Grand mental health they've they're also doing work so a lot of uh efforts are going on in this homeless Arena but one of the things that is going to be a top priority for me is fixing our permitting issues at City Hall we have any number of people who are trying to build more affordable housing Habitat for Humanity those groups by the time they get through all of Permitting the homes are no longer affordable because it takes too long costs too much money so we've got to fix that we've got to make sure that our city is a partner to these developers so that's a number one priority and and I will do everything that I can in that space to make sure that that is fixed very quickly um now we are going to talk about the money for your government no plans to raise well I'll just a little bit about myself um I do I love Tulsa and I worked with the mayor years ago because our downtown was dead so 20 years ago you know nothing was happening downtown and I I was very interested in it took a group of people to Oklahoma City to to look at what they were doing with their maps program and came back here and the mayor at the time had an opening and I begged him for the job and I got it and I was able to work on what was called Vision 2025 and we built the B Arena and we uh past funds it was a revolving fund so that we can invest in some of these old Office Buildings and turn them into apartments and so now we have this amus I mean we have this amazing vibrant downtown and it's so much fun to go down there uh and a lot of those dollars were dispersed throughout the community so um I I'm really proud of that work um and then after that one of the folks that I worked with who was a county commissioner at the time encouraged me to run for County Commission and then I did and I've been doing that for 16 years and I have worked well across party lines to get federal dollars to help fix our levies and then our state legislature this spring also pitched in on that I've worked in Economic Development uh for you know to get uh an industrial park out of the ground uh in a very challenging census track and it's now thriving you know I've worked on any number of projects I'm really proud of the work I've done these last 16 years and I'm ready to go to work day one I know all of our legislators I know everybody at our Chamber of Commerce I
